When Is The Best Time To Plant Sunflowers In Central Florida. The average time between planting and bloom is roughly 65 days. The best time to plant sunflowers in florida is after the risk of frost has passed. In central florida, it’s best to plant after the last frost, typically late winter or early spring. The best time to plant sunflowers in florida is from march to october. Timing is everything when planting sunflowers. The south region enjoys a longer growing season due to its mild winter weather, allowing for sunflower planting from january through may. This is because sunflowers require warm temperatures and. The soil temperature should be at least 55°f for seeds to germinate properly. The best time to plant sunflowers in florida is after the last average frost date for your area, usually in late winter to early spring. You can typically plant sunflowers in florida beginning in late winter.
